Restoration Estimator & Project Manager
Black River Design Build | Milwaukee / North Shore Area

Black River Design Build is looking for a highly organized, client-focused Restoration Estimator & Project Manager to join our growing team.

Established in 1994, Black River Design Build is a design-build remodeling and restoration company serving homeowners throughout Milwaukee, the North Shore, and surrounding communities. Our Restoration Division helps clients navigate difficult, often stressful situations involving water, fire, storm, and insurance-related damage. We are looking for someone who can bring professionalism, clear communication, strong construction knowledge, and calm leadership to every project.

This role is ideal for someone who understands both the technical side of estimating and the people side of project management. The right person will be comfortable meeting with homeowners, documenting project conditions, preparing accurate scopes and estimates, working with insurance carriers when needed, coordinating trade partners, and managing projects from first inspection through completion.

Position Summary

The Restoration Estimator & Project Manager will be responsible for evaluating restoration projects, preparing detailed estimates, communicating clearly with clients and insurance representatives, coordinating production, and ensuring each project is completed with quality, efficiency, and professionalism.

This person will serve as a key point of contact for homeowners throughout the restoration process and will be responsible for helping turn a stressful situation into a well-managed, well-communicated experience.

Key Responsibilities

Estimating & Project Evaluation

  • Meet with homeowners to inspect and evaluate restoration-related damage.
  • Document existing conditions with photos, measurements, notes, and clear scope information.
  • Prepare accurate restoration estimates based on field conditions, construction requirements, and project needs.
  • Review insurance scopes and identify missing, inaccurate, or incomplete items when applicable.
  • Communicate scope details clearly with clients, insurance adjusters, internal team members, and trade partners.
  • Help establish realistic budgets, schedules, expectations, and production plans.
Project Management

  • Manage restoration projects from approval through completion.
  • Coordinate labor, materials, subcontractors, inspections, schedules, and client communication.
  • Ensure work is completed according to Black River Design Build standards, project scope, applicable codes, and client expectations.
  • Proactively identify issues in the field and help resolve them before they become larger problems.
  • Keep projects moving while maintaining quality, safety, cleanliness, and professionalism.
  • Perform jobsite visits, progress checks, and final walkthroughs.
  • Maintain accurate project documentation throughout the life of each job.
Client Communication

  • Serve as a trusted guide for homeowners throughout the restoration process.
  • Communicate clearly, professionally, and regularly regarding schedule, scope, changes, next steps, and expectations.
  • Help clients understand the difference between insurance-covered work, required repairs, and optional upgrades.
  • Represent Black River Design Build with integrity, empathy, and professionalism.
Internal Coordination

  • Work closely with office staff, production teams, estimators, designers, subcontractors, and leadership.
  • Provide clear handoffs between estimating, approvals, production, billing, and closeout.
  • Support a positive, team-oriented work environment.
  • Help improve systems, processes, documentation, and client experience within the Restoration Division.

Preferred Experience

  • Residential remodeling or restoration experience.
  • Insurance restoration estimating experience.
  • Project management experience in construction or remodeling.
  • Familiarity with water, fire, storm, and structural repair scopes.
  • Experience working with insurance adjusters and supplementing claims.
  • Familiarity with estimating software, construction management software, or CRM systems.
  • Ability to read plans, scopes, sketches, and construction documents.
  • Knowledge of building codes, permitting, inspections, and residential construction sequencing.
